The Rimrock Resort Hotel, Banff Alberta Apr 27, 2009
The Rimrock Resort Hotel overlooks the town of Banff, Alberta. The location is great. The hot springs and sightseeing gondolas are a short walk from the hotel and there is a free shuttle service to the town. There is a nice pool, gym, dry and steam sauna, and a large hot tub; all of which have a great view of the mountains.
I stayed here to attend some leadership training offered by my employer. The training took up the entire day, so being able to relax in the pool at night was appreciated. I didn't like a few things with the place. First, I'd like to say that the breakfast and room service were expensive, hardly original, the service was extremely slow, and the food did not taste good. Second, the service in the entire hotel was poor, and third, the bed was rock hard and very uncomfortable. Most of the group ended up eating in town during the week, which was a lot better. Overall, I think there are better places to stay in Banff. |
